A fuel tank caught fire following an incident involving a drone near Dubai International Airport on Monday. However, the fire has been brought under control and no injuries have been reported. As a precautionary measure, all flights have been temporarily halted and passengers have been advised to seek updates from their airlines.

Dubai Airport Attack: Amid rising tensions in the Middle East, a suspicious drone attack took place near Dubai International Airport (DXB), one of the world’s busiest airports, on Monday. After this attack, a massive fire broke out in a fuel tank located near the airport. Due to security reasons, the movement of aircraft at Dubai Airport has been completely stopped. However, it is a matter of relief that the fire was brought under control within some time and there is no news of anyone being injured in this incident.

Fuel tank caught fire due to drone collision

According to Dubai Media Office, a fuel tank was affected in a drone-related incident near the airport, following which a fire broke out. Emergency services immediately arrived at the scene and Dubai Civil Defense teams acted swiftly to stop the fire from spreading. Officials later confirmed that the fire had been successfully brought under control and there were no casualties. During this time, security protocols were activated in the entire area so that passengers, employees and people living nearby can be kept safe.

All flights stopped as a precaution

After the drone incident, Dubai Civil Aviation Authority temporarily suspended all flights at the airport as a precaution. Officials have advised passengers to contact the airlines directly for information regarding their flights and wait for official updates. The stoppage of flights in a global travel hub like Dubai is being considered as big news for travelers around the world, as this airport handles thousands of international passengers every day.

Concern increased amid Middle East tension

This incident has happened at a time when the security situation in the region is already sensitive due to the ongoing conflict in the Middle East. According to reports, during the recent conflict, Iran has fired more than 1800 missiles and drones towards UAE. However, most of them were intercepted by the air defense system on the way. Due to this war, there is a possibility of targeting many important places in the Gulf region like airports, ports and oil facilities.
